Delta Police Command Arrest One For Breaking Government Seal In Asaba

ASABA/Nigeria: A staff of Chipet Petrol Station, along the Asaba-Onitsha Express Way, in Asaba, the state capital, has been arrested by the police for breaking the Delta State Government seal in the premises of the filling station.

The team of the combined Taskforce on Ground Rent, Operation Show Your Building Plan and others discovered the misdeed during an enforcement, monitoring exercise on sealed up business premises in Asaba.

The crime was said to have been committed earlier for which a reseal up was ensured by the combined taskforce before a second attempt was committed by the defaulter of the earlier notice served management of the station.

The Chairman of the taskforce, Mr. Chidi Nwuko, disclosed that the said business premise had been sealed up earlier for failure to present approved building plan and other title documents for verification within a stipulated period.

Mr. Nwuko expressed displeasure at the incessant manner citizens, who should be law abiding, flagrantly flouted the law.

He condemned the unpatriotic act in its entirety and reiterated the resolve of the state government to clamp down decisively on defaulters of all land and property related levies, stressing that compliance was a statutory obligation that those concerned must adhere to strictly.

While expressing the belief that the arrest would serve as a deterrent to others, he called on business owners as well as land and property developers to imbibe the sense of responsibility by adhering to the rules, governing their operations in the state.

Earlier, over twenty building construction sites were sealed up, following failure to present proof of payments of land and property related charges by their owners in the state capital territory.
